Understanding the Basics

Hybrid Coating 2:1 Batch Mix 85A is a specific type of polyurea coating, and its name holds some key information about its composition. Let’s break it down:

  1. Hybrid Coating: This indicates that the product is a hybrid formulation, combining the strengths of different chemical components. In the world of polyurea coatings, hybrids are known for their ability to strike a balance between various desirable properties, such as hardness, flexibility, and chemical resistance.
  2. 2:1 Batch Mix: This ratio signifies the mixing proportions of the two primary components of the coating, usually referred to as the “A” and “B” components. In this case, the “A” component is mixed with the “B” component in a 2:1 ratio. This precise mixing ratio is crucial to achieve the desired performance characteristics and ensure proper curing.
  3. 85A: The “85A” designation is a measure of the hardness or durometer of the cured polyurea coating. In the Shore durometer scale, a higher number indicates greater hardness. An 85A rating suggests that the cured coating has a moderately hard yet somewhat flexible texture, making it suitable for a wide range of applications.

Key Characteristics

Hybrid Coating 2:1 Batch Mix 85A exhibits several key characteristics that make it a preferred choice for various protective coating and waterproofing applications:

  1. Rapid Cure Time: One of the standout features of this polyurea formulation is its incredibly fast curing time. Once the “A” and “B” components are mixed in the prescribed ratio, the coating begins to cure rapidly. This swift curing process reduces downtime during application and allows for quicker project completion.
  2. Durability and Toughness: With its 85A hardness rating, this coating strikes a balance between hardness and flexibility. It provides excellent abrasion resistance, impact resistance, and durability, making it ideal for high-traffic areas or surfaces exposed to harsh environmental conditions.
  3. Chemical Resistance: Hybrid Coating 2:1 Batch Mix 85A exhibits impressive resistance to a wide range of chemicals, including acids, bases, solvents, and oils. This chemical resistance makes it suitable for applications where exposure to corrosive substances is a concern.
  4. Waterproofing Properties: Due to its rapid curing and seamless application, this polyurea coating is an excellent choice for waterproofing applications. It forms a tight, impermeable barrier that effectively seals surfaces and prevents water intrusion.
  5. Versatility: The versatility of this coating is a significant advantage. It can be applied to various substrates, including concrete, steel, wood, and more. Whether it’s used for industrial flooring, roof coatings, tank linings, or containment systems, this coating adapts to diverse environments and surface types.

Applications

The versatility and exceptional properties of Hybrid Coating 2:1 Batch Mix 85A lend themselves to a wide range of applications across different industries:

  1. Industrial Flooring: The rapid cure time and durability of this coating make it a popular choice for industrial flooring systems. It can withstand heavy machinery, foot traffic, and exposure to chemicals, ensuring long-lasting performance.
  2. Roof Coatings: As a waterproofing solution, this polyurea coating is frequently used to protect roofs from leaks, UV radiation, and extreme weather conditions. Its quick curing time minimizes the risk of weather-related delays during installation.
  3. Tank Linings: For containment and corrosion protection in tanks and vessels that store various liquids, including chemicals and wastewater, Hybrid Coating 2:1 Batch Mix 85A offers an effective and durable solution.
  4. Infrastructure Protection: Bridges, tunnels, and other critical infrastructure elements benefit from the protective qualities of this coating. It guards against corrosion, erosion, and environmental damage.
  5. Automotive and Marine Applications: The combination of toughness and chemical resistance makes this coating suitable for automotive undercoating and marine coatings, where exposure to saltwater and harsh conditions is common.
